By screening a Pimpinella brachycarpa shoot tip cDNA library with the soybean homeo-domain-leucine zipper (HD-Aip) gene, Gmhl, as a probe, we isolated three cDNA clones, Phz1, Phz2, and Phz4, encoding polypeptides that contain a homeodomain and a closely linked leucine zipper motif. In both nucleotide and deduced amino acid sequences, Phz1, Phz2, and Phz4 were highly homologous to two Arabidopsis thaliana HD-Zip genes, a soybean HD-Zip gene and a tomato HD-Zip gene in an HD-Aip motif. Genomic Southern blot analysis indicated that Phz2 and Phz4 are members of a multigene family. RNase protection assay revealed that Phz2 and Phz4 are expressed at all organs including leaves, petioles, roots and shoot tips. So far, these HD- Zip proteins have been found only in dicotyledonous plants. Thus, it may be speculated that Phz1, Phz2, and Phz4 proteins could impart functional characters unique to the dicotyledonous plants that would express them in processes common to those plants.
